A pensioner who collapsed on the London Underground has described how selfish commuters ignored him as they trampled over him to catch their trains.

Widower Maurice Grange, who lost his wife Esme in October, was left covered in bruises when he fainted on the escalator at Waterloo Station on December 23.

The 81-year-old was dragged to the bottom of the lift and left barely conscious as people walked over him as he lay on the floor.

Describing the ordeal, Mr Green said: “I just collapsed. It was very busy and the escalator was going quite quickly and the next thing I knew I was on the floor and people were walking all over me.

"It just scooped me up and dragged me down onto the platform.

"I’m still bruised from the fall - there was shoes and boots coming right onto me.”

The distressed former civil servant was finally given help by a young family, who helped him up of the ground and showed him to his train.

Mr Green, who was travelling from his home in Dorset to Yorkshire to spend Christmas with his daughter, now wants to find the family who helped him so that he can thank them.

He added: "It was a young man and woman with a four-year-old boy and a toddler girl and a push chair I think.

"They helped me to my feet and held me for a while, as I couldn’t really stand up.

"Then they took me to my train and made sure I got on it.

"I didn’t really think to ask them for any details, but I remember they told me they’re from Birmingham.

"I just wish I’d got some contact details for them, I really just want to say thank you.”

Mr Green lost his wife after she lost a six year fight with dementia.

He said: “I had been thinking about Esme a lot, because it’s been really quite hard these last few years and especially since I lost her.

"We’d been married for 51 years.

"I’ve never had anything like this before, no funny turns, but I was thinking about her just before I fell and I think that might have been it.”
